Technological Disruption & Innovation in South Korea New Energy Vehicle Drive Motor Cores Market South Korea’s drive motor cores market is witnessing significant technological disruption driven by innovations in materials, design, and manufacturing processes. The adoption of rare-earth magnets, such as neodymium, enhances magnetic flux density, enabling higher torque and efficiency. Advances in thermal management, including liquid cooling systems, extend motor lifespan and performance under demanding conditions. Emerging trends include the integration of sensor technology for real-time diagnostics, AI-driven control systems for optimized performance, and the development of lightweight composite materials to reduce vehicle weight. Additive manufacturing techniques are also being explored to enable rapid prototyping and customization. Supply Chain Analysis of South Korea New Energy Vehicle Drive Motor Cores Market The supply chain for drive motor cores in South Korea is highly integrated, with key raw materials sourced domestically and internationally. Rare-earth magnets, copper, and silicon steel are critical inputs, with South Korean firms actively diversifying sources to mitigate geopolitical risks. Vertical integration among major players ensures tighter control over quality and cost. Global supply chain disruptions, especially in rare-earth materials, have prompted strategic stockpiling and local sourcing initiatives. Logistics and manufacturing hubs are concentrated around Seoul and Ulsan, leveraging advanced infrastructure. The supply chain’s resilience is bolstered by government support for critical material development and recycling initiatives.
